Mathematics Reignites in Ada Lovelace
It was in fact Charles Babbage himself who engaged
Augustus De Morgan as mathematics instructor for Ada Lovelace.
Ada enjoyed learning mathematics as the
more she learnt the more she discovered that she had this innate gift of
mathematical thinking.

By the year of 1840 when she was 25 Ada
wrote a letter to her mother in which she clearly stated that mathematics would
become her life mission:
“I believe myself to possess a most
singular combination of qualities exactly fitted to make me pre-eminently a
discoverer of hidden realities of nature.”

At this same time Babbage was working on
his analytical machine but already he was being less appreciated in his own
country as the difference engine proved to be not only a commercial failure but
also a financial disaster.
17,500 Pounds of the British Crown had sunk
down the drain for construction of this machine and nowhere was there any sign
of the machine becoming a physical reality.
Just so that you get a reasonable relation
of its worth, this amount is roughly equivalent to 2 million American dollars
of the year 2016!
Strangely enough, Babbage managed to get
attention of enlightened people in Italy of all the countries.
In 1840 Babbage gave a lecture in the
University of Turin where a certain general by the name of Luigi Federico
Menabrea sat in the lecture hall taking down notes.
Menabrea is yet another interesting
character of the analytical engine story even though he comes in here very
fleetingly.
